Current situation of the provincial capital of Yunnan
To this day, Kunming is still the provincial capital of Yunnan. As the political, economic and cultural center of Yunnan, Kunming plays an important role in various fields. The Yunnan Provincial Government is located in Kunming, where government agencies at all levels and large enterprises and institutions are also concentrated. Kunming's economy is developing rapidly and it is the most important economic growth pole in Yunnan Province.
In addition, Kunming is also the transportation hub of Yunnan, with a developed aviation, railway and highway transportation network. From Kunming, you can easily reach other cities in Yunnan, as well as surrounding provinces and countries. This also further consolidates Kunming's status as the capital of Yunnan Province.
